The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has successfully managed to put its Hope Probe into an orbit around Mars, making it the first Mars mission successfully conducted by the Arab world.
On February 8, 2021, the spacecraft beamed back a signal confirming its place in Martian orbit, effectively winning a sort-of friendly race between the UAE, China, and the U.S. to see which country’s most recent Mars mission could reach the Red Planet first.
